PostgreSQL TODO List
====================
Current maintainer: Bruce Momjian (pgman@candle.pha.pa.us)
-Last updated: Sat Jul 30 00:05:03 EDT 2005
+Last updated: Sat Jul 30 23:08:20 EDT 2005
The most recent version of this document can be viewed at
http://www.postgresql.org/docs/faqs.TODO.html.
o Allow postgresql.conf file values to be changed via an SQL API
o Allow the server to be stopped/restarted via an SQL API
+ * Allow server logs to be remotely read using SQL commands
+
* Tablespaces
* Add ability to monitor the use of temporary sort files
* -Add session start time and last statement time to pg_stat_activity
-* Allow server logs to be remotely read using SQL commands
* -Add a function that returns the start time of the postmaster
throw an error on overflow
* Add 'tid != tid ' operator for use in corruption recovery
+
* Dates and Times
o Allow infinite dates just like infinite timestamps
enable_constraint_exclusion
* Allow EXPLAIN output to be more easily processed by scripts
+
* CREATE
o Allow CREATE TABLE AS to determine column lengths for complex
* psql
+
o Have psql show current values for a sequence
o Move psql backslash database information into the backend, use
mnemonic commands? [psql]
* -Add two-phase commit
+
* Add the features of packages
o Make private objects accessable only to objects in the same schema
* Allow enable_constraint_exclusion to work for UNIONs like it does for
inheritance
* Allow enable_constraint_exclusion to work for UPDATE and DELETE queries
+
+
* GIST
o Add more GIST index support for geometric data types
when the first valid heap lookup happens. This bit would have to
be cleared when a heap tuple is expired.
+
* Consider automatic caching of queries at various levels:
+
o Parsed query tree
o Query execute plan
o Query results
the event of a system crash, the bitmap would probably be invalidated.
* Add system view to show free space map contents
+
+
* Auto-vacuum
o -Move into the backend code
* Fix sgmltools so PDFs can be generated with bookmarks
* Add C code on Unix to copy directories for use in creating new databases
+
* Win32
o Remove configure.in check for link failure when cause is found
like towupper(). However, UTF8 already works with normal
locales but provides no ordering or character set classes.
+
* Wire Protocol Changes
o Allow dynamic character set handling
<body bgcolor="#FFFFFF" text="#000000" link="#FF0000" vlink="#A00000" alink="#0000FF">
<h1><a name="section_1">PostgreSQL TODO List</a></h1>
<p>Current maintainer: Bruce Momjian (<a href="mailto:pgman@candle.pha.pa.us">pgman@candle.pha.pa.us</a>)<br/>
-Last updated: Sat Jul 30 00:05:03 EDT 2005
+Last updated: Sat Jul 30 23:08:20 EDT 2005
</p>
<p>The most recent version of this document can be viewed at<br/>
<a href="http://www.postgresql.org/docs/faqs.TODO.html">http://www.postgresql.org/docs/faqs.TODO.html</a>.
</p>
</li><li>Allow postgresql.conf file values to be changed via an SQL API
</li><li>Allow the server to be stopped/restarted via an SQL API
+ <ul>
+ <li>Allow server logs to be remotely read using SQL commands
+ </li></ul>
</li></ul>
</li><li>Tablespaces
<ul>
</p>
</li><li>Add ability to monitor the use of temporary sort files
</li><li>-<em>Add session start time and last statement time to pg_stat_activity</em>
- </li><li>Allow server logs to be remotely read using SQL commands
</li><li>-<em>Add a function that returns the start time of the postmaster</em>
</li></ul>
<h1><a name="section_4">Data Types</a></h1>